+ ## Local Mode Explained
119
+
120
+ - If `apiUrl` is omitted or points to `localhost`/`127.0.0.1`, the SDK runs in local mode.
121
+ - Local mode integrates seamlessly with the `spaps` CLI (`npx spaps local`), defaulting to `http://localhost:3300`.
122
+ - No API key is required in local mode; tokens and data are managed locally for development.
123
+
124
+ You can check the mode at runtime:
125
+
126
+ ```ts
127
+ spaps.isLocalMode(); // true | false
128
+ ```
129
+
130
+ ## Environment Variables
131
+
132
+ The SDK can read configuration from environment variables (useful in Next.js and Node):
133
+
134
+ - `SPAPS_API_URL` or `NEXT_PUBLIC_SPAPS_API_URL` — API base URL
135
+ - `SPAPS_API_KEY` — API key for production use
136
+
137
+ Example (Node):
138
+
139
+ ```bash
140
+ export SPAPS_API_URL=https://api.sweetpotato.dev
141
+ export SPAPS_API_KEY=spaps_xxx
142
+ ```
143
+
144
+ Example (Next.js):
145
+
146
+ ```env
147
+ NEXT_PUBLIC_SPAPS_API_URL=https://api.sweetpotato.dev
148
+ ```
